Question: It is said the hospital is equipped with an incinerator. The person whose organs were removed will be burned when he or she is still alive. Is that true?
Answer: The employees in our hospital call this place "the incinerator." Actually, it is a boiler room. Some poor farmers from nearby places were hired to work in the boiler room. They were penniless when they first came here. But they could scrape up some watches, finger rings, necklaces, and so on. The amount is not small. It is said by the employees in the hospital these jewelry and watches were collected from the Falun Gong practitioners whose organs had been removed when they were about to be thrown in the boiler to be burned. It is also said by the employees in the hospital, some were still alive when being thrown into the boiler.
Question: Do they get injection of anesthetic when in surgery?
Answer: Yes. There is a cap to the anesthetic quantity used in mainland China's hospitals. Generally, the supply of anesthetic was determined according to the accommodation of the hospital. To the public, the number of patients in our care appears to be very small, and publicly reported number of surgical procedures performed is quite low. But the equipment and articles used in surgery are abundant. Because the amount of anesthetic is limited, these secret surgeries could not use the normal anesthetic doses. In order to save anesthetic, they economized on the anesthetic used in surgeries on these Falun Gong practitioners. The amount of anesthetic used was very small. However, many whose organs were removed were still alive. You can imagine the pain suffered by the Falun Gong practitioners whose organs were removed.
Question: Are there any survivors among the 6,000 people detained since 2001?
Answer: Nobody has come out alive. The number of them gets smaller and smaller. The Falun Gong practitioners detained at Sujiatun are fewer now than before. But I believe that the sin of removing the organs of the Falun Gong practitioners is still continuing.

Dude, why don't you look at the third side of the story, that the Chinese gov't has an OFFICIAL POLICY of prosecuting peaceful Falun Gong practitioners, or for that matter, anyone who doesn't subscribe to the standard state ideology of the People's Republic of China... Falun Gong is a practice based on faith, morals, and aspects of health... the government suppresses demonstrations by practitioners by violence, bans publication of their materials... why? Because no other organization that has the potential to draw support and faith should exist alongside the Communist Party.
I'm not saying the organ farming is true or untrue either, but they put "Falun Gong" in quotes because they don't recognize the faith and they don't even think these people should be alive.
Why would you trust a quote from a government official whose country blocks "controversial" internet sites so its citizens can live in some self-contained, perfect little state-controls-media world?
